What are the main differences between inpatient and outpatient addiction treatment programs available in Durango, CO?

In Durango, inpatient (residential) programs, such as those offered by Axis Health System or Four Corners Health, provide 24/7 structured care in a live-in facility, ideal for severe addictions or unstable home environments. Outpatient programs, like those at The Recovery Village at Palmer Lake (with local connections) or Mercy Regional Medical Center's behavioral health services, allow individuals to live at home while attending scheduled therapy sessions, suitable for those with strong support systems or work commitments. The choice often depends on addiction severity, insurance coverage, and personal responsibilities.

How does Durango's remote location and outdoor environment influence addiction treatment options here?

Durango's remote setting in the San Juan Mountains means fewer large-scale facilities but promotes unique wilderness and adventure therapies, with programs incorporating hiking, skiing, or river activities to build coping skills and reduce stress. However, residents may need to travel to nearby cities like Grand Junction or Denver for certain specialized inpatient services, though local outpatient care is robust. The natural surroundings also support holistic approaches, with some centers emphasizing mindfulness and outdoor recreation as part of recovery, aligning with Colorado's wellness-focused culture.

When looking for addiction rehab near you, it's important to understand the types of programs available. Durango and the surrounding region offer various levels of care to meet different needs. These can range from outpatient programs, which allow you to live at home while attending therapy and counseling sessions, to more intensive options. Some individuals may benefit from a partial hospitalization program (PHP) or an intensive outpatient program (IOP), which provide structured treatment during the day. For those requiring a residential setting, there are reputable facilities within a reasonable distance that offer 24/7 care in a dedicated, healing environment. The key is to find a program that aligns with your specific circumstances, the substance involved, and your personal recovery goals. A quality treatment center will begin with a comprehensive assessment to create an individualized plan. Effective addiction treatment in our area typically integrates multiple approaches. This often includes evidence-based therapies like c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) and dialectical behavior therapy (DBT), which help you understand the thoughts and behaviors linked to addiction. Many programs also incorporate group therapy, providing peer support, and individual counseling to address underlying issues such as trauma, anxiety, or depression. Given Durango's active culture, some local providers may integrate holistic wellness practices like adventure therapy, mindfulness in nature, or physical activity, leveraging our stunning landscape as part of the healing process.
